
Manchester United's David de Gea is named in goal while Dimitri Payet is also included,. Leicester are represented by captain Wes Morgan and their three individual nominees - Jamie Vardy, Riyad Mahrez and N'Golo Kante, while Harry Kane, Dele Alli, Danny Rose and Toby Alderweireld are Spurs' four inclusions.
The PFA, which had planned to reveal the Teams of the Year on Sunday at its awards dinner, was forced to release the information on Thursday afternoon after the Premier League team was leaked in a photograph on social media.
A statement on the organisation's website read: “The PFA is disappointed that a member of the public has chosen to deliberately leak our representative teams from the official brochure of the Awards Evening. As a matter of urgency, we are seeking a detailed explanation from the brochure printers as to how they were able to secure a copy of the publication. The unveiling of the PFA representative teams is eagerly awaited by our members and football fans throughout the country and we hope that the unfortunate leak does not affect the wide-ranging debate and discussion which accompanies their normal release on the day of the event”
The individual player awards will be revealed on Sunday evening.
